3DescriptionCVE.org
Under certain circumstances on affected platforms running Arista EOS with gRPC Network Packet Sampling Interface (gNPSI) enabled, an unauthenticated gNPSI client can craft a malicious request to allow arbitrary code execution, granting an attacker full administrative control over the compromised switch.
AnalysisAI
Arbitrary code execution in Arista EOS with the gRPC Network Packet Sampling Interface (gNPSI) enabled allows an unauthenticated gNPSI client to craft a malicious request that executes code on the switch, yielding full administrative control of the device. The exploit path is gated by a hard precondition: gNPSI is not enabled by default and the gRPC endpoint must be network-reachable, which the vendor vector captures as AT:P and the advisory describes as 'under certain circumstances'; given that condition, no authentication (PR:N) or user interaction (UI:N) is needed. …

Recommended ActionAI
Within 24 hours, inventory all Arista EOS switches and identify any that have gNPSI enabled and network-reachable; if gNPSI is not required, disable it, and block the gRPC endpoint from untrusted networks using ACLs or firewall rules. …
